Compounding Pharmacies: Tailoring Treatments to Individual Needs
Compounding pharmacies differentiate themselves from traditional drugstores by providing customized medications customized to meet individual patient needs. This involves the synthesis of medications in their facility, using superior ingredients and specific dosages.
Compounding pharmacists work alongside physicians to develop unique treatment plans, often addressing specialized medical requirements.
These pharmacies play a crucial role in supplying solutions for patients with allergies to commercial medications, as well as those demanding specific pharmaceutical presentations.
Grasping Active Pharmaceutical Ingredients (APIs)
Active pharmaceutical ingredients (APIs) are the fundamental building blocks of drugs. These materials are accountable for producing the medical effects sought after in patients. APIs are carefully evaluated and regulated by government agencies to ensure their potency.
A in-depth understanding of APIs is crucial for researchers, pharmaceutical companies, nurses, and anyone concerned about the development and use of medicines.

Understanding Prescription vs. Nonprescription Drugs
When it comes to medications, there are distinct primary categories: prescription drugs and over-the-counter (OTC) drugs. They represent distinct classifications based on their intended effects and the level of medical guidance required for their use.
Prescription drugs are designed to address severe medical conditions. They require a doctor's order from a licensed healthcare practitioner before they can be dispensed by a pharmacist. In contrast, OTC drugs are obtainable without a prescription and are intended to relieve mild health concerns.
- Moreover, prescription drugs undergo extensive testing and evaluation by regulatory bodies before they can be licensed for market. OTC drugs also undergo safety evaluations, but the process is typically less intensive.
- Adverse reactions associated with prescription drugs can sometimes be severe than those of OTC drugs, warranting careful monitoring by a healthcare provider.
